THE HAMILTON BRANCH RAILWAY.

The Chairman of the Hamilton Highway Board has written the following letter to the Minister for Public Works :—: — Sir, — As the Government have decided to close the Hamilton Branch line for the present, for purposes of economy, may I most respectfully suggest that the same may be sold by public auction at once in Hamilton at per month, or until such time as the Government may wish to resume running the trains. The closing this line will prove a great inconvenience to the public who h*ve heavy goods to transport, and aa the winter season is approaching, it will necessitate a large expenditure to keep the road in a fit state to carry the traffic. If the Government cannot see their way to adopt this suggestion, I would respectfully request, on behalf of the Board, that the Government provide the money necessary to keep this road in repair ; for allowing that the closing the line will be a saving to the Government, it will be done at the expense of the local bodies, namely of this Board and the Hamilton Borough, and in the present condition of the Boards finances, they are not in a position to undertake this work. It will be an expenditure they have made no provision for in allotting the outlay for the several portions of their district at the beginning of their term of office. Moat of these works are completed and when fully so, this Board will be without funds, Trusting the Government will give these suggestions a favorable consideration, I have, &c, Samuel Steele, Chairman, H.H.B.
